Transaction 78fe415d460976d2b264f17642a16da1d67d2aafbf24e572818c7464e65c8be7
1 Input
2 Outputs
- 78fe415d460976d2b264f17642a16da1d67d2aafbf24e572818c7464e65c8be7:0
- 78fe415d460976d2b264f17642a16da1d67d2aafbf24e572818c7464e65c8be7:1
value 2352739
address 1wxeZhmMP1phpK4vuJ9SABgMQq395EGF3
value 27735942
address 34vxoLYdAgMSQU9Bf4arLsWGy55ZPBNKoH